Rustavi experiences four distinct seasons with an average annual temperature of 55°F (13°C). Winters average 35°F in January while summers reach 77°F in July. Annual precipitation totals 19.8 inches (drier than the 38-inch national average). The city sits at an elevation of 1,132 feet.

Monthly Weather

Month Avg Temperature Precipitation Summary
January 35°F (2°C) 0.8 in Coldest, Driest
February 37°F (3°C) 1.1 in
March 44°F (7°C) 1.4 in
April 55°F (13°C) 2.0 in
May 63°F (17°C) 2.9 in
June 70°F (21°C) 3.1 in Wettest
July 77°F (25°C) 1.8 in Warmest
August 76°F (24°C) 1.7 in
September 68°F (20°C) 1.3 in
October 57°F (14°C) 1.7 in
November 46°F (8°C) 1.3 in
December 38°F (4°C) 0.8 in

Rustavi has a seasonal temperature swing of 42°F / from 35°F in January to 77°F in July. Total annual precipitation is 19.8 inches, with June being the wettest month (3.1") and January the driest (0.8").
